Eucalyptus essential oil is widely valued for its therapeutic properties and extensive commercial applications, with chemical composition significantly influenced by species variety, geographical origin, environmental conditions. This study aims to develop a reliable method identifying the origin variety of eucalyptus samples through application advanced analytical techniques combined chemometric methods. ABSTRACT Lavender, widely cultivated in the Mediterranean region, produces essential oil known for its significant biological activities and is a key component of perfume industry due to high levels Linalool Linalyl acetate, along with low Camphor content, which contributes cost. However, market plagued by adulterated lavender oil, often mixed cheaper alternatives such as eucalyptus rosemary.
